# shiplet-example-react-vite-ts

> Shiplet example — **React 18 + TypeScript + SWC** via **Vite 5**, running on **Docker** with Redis and pnpm.

## Stack

| Service   | Image          | Port | Purpose               |
| --------- | -------------- | ---- | --------------------- |
| **app**   | node:22-slim   | 5173 | Vite dev server + HMR |
| **redis** | redis:7-alpine | 6379 | Cache / state store   |

## Quick Start

```bash
# Requires Docker Desktop or Docker Engine + Compose plugin
shiplet up -d
shiplet pnpm install
# Vite dev server starts automatically via compose command:
# → http://localhost:5173
```

## Key Docker/Vite settings

The `vite.config.ts` in this example includes the settings required for HMR inside Docker:

```ts
server: {
  host: '0.0.0.0',       // listen on all container interfaces
  port: 5173,
  hmr: {
    host: 'localhost',   // browser connects to localhost (the host machine)
    port: 5173,
  },
  watch: {
    usePolling: true,    // needed when files are in Docker volumes on some OSes
    interval: 300,
  },
}
```

Without `host: '0.0.0.0'`, the dev server only listens on the container's loopback and is unreachable from your browser.

Without `usePolling: true`, file changes may not be detected on Linux hosts with certain filesystem configurations.
